Capillary electrophoresis with on-line sample pretreatment for the analysis of biological samples with direct injection

1993 
Abstract A method of capillary electrophoresis (CE) using on-line sample pretreatment was developed. The system utilized on-line solid-phase extraction and capillary column switching. To explore the advantages of the method, propranolol in serum was determined by direct injection. lie pretreatment part of the system consisted of an injection capillary including a small bed of protein-coated ODS. The protein-coated ODS concentrated the analyte by hydrophobic interactions, and the serum proteins were allowed to flow into a drain capillary. As samples up to ca . 1 μl could be loaded without a decrease in resolution, the detection limit was improved by two orders of magnitude (0.15 μg/ml). Propranolol was detected in a separation capillary by UV absorbance measurement without any interfering peaks. A linear response was obtained between 100 fg and 2 ng per injection. This method provides novel possibilities for extending the application of capillary electrophoresis.
